Classic Mushroom Sauce

Prep Time:10 mins
Cook Time:20 mins
Total Time:30 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 3 tablespoons Unsalted butter
  • 1 tablespoon Olive oil
  • 250 grams Cremini mushrooms, sliced
  • 2 cloves Gar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on All-purpose flour
  • 1.5 cups Chicken or vegetable stock
  • 0.5 cup Heavy cream
  • 1 teaspoon Fresh thyme leaves
  • 0.5 teaspoon Salt
  • 0.25 teaspoon Black pepper
  • 1 tablespoon Fresh parsley, chopped (optional for garnish)

Directions

Step 1

In a large skillet, heat the butter and olive oil over medium heat until the butter is melted and bubbling.

Step 2

Add the sliced mushrooms and cook for 5-7 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the mushrooms are browned and have released most of their moisture.

Step 3

Add the minced garlic and cook for 1 additional minute, stirring constantly to prevent burning.

Step 4

Sprinkle the flour over the mushrooms and stir until the flour is evenly distributed and has absorbed the pan's liquid, about 1 minute.

Step 5

Gradually pour in the chicken or vegetable stock while whisking constantly to avoid lumps. Bring the mixture to a simmer.

Step 6

Lower the heat to medium-low and stir in the heavy cream, fresh thyme leaves, salt, and black pepper. Simmer for 5-7 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the sauce thickens to your desired consistency.

Step 7

Taste and adjust seasoning if needed. Remove the skillet from the heat.

Step 8

Garnish with fresh parsley if desired and serve immediately over your choice of steak, chicken, pasta, or mashed potatoes.
